Overview

Power and Style for Your Everyday Tasks

Introducing the Dell Inspiron 3910 Desktop, a perfect blend of performance and aesthetics for your home or office. Equipped with a 12th Gen Intel Core i7 processor, ample memory, and dual storage, this desktop is designed to handle multitasking, content creation, and everyday computing with ease. Its stylish design and reliable performance make it an excellent addition to any workspace.

  • Processor: 12th Gen Intel Core i7-12700 8-Core 2.50 GHz Processor (up to 4.90 GHz)
  • Memory: 8GB DDR4 3200 MHz
  • Storage: 1TB NVMe SSD + 8TB SATA Hard Drive
  • Graphics: Integrated Intel UHD Graphics 730
  • Operating System: Windows 11 Home
  • Connectivity: Intel Wi-Fi 6 2x2 (Gig+) + Bluetooth, Gigabit Ethernet (RJ-45)
  • Ports: 3x USB 3.2 Gen 1 Type-A, 1x USB 3.2 Gen 1 Type-C, 4 x USB 2.0, 1 x HDMI, 1 x DisplayPort, Audio Combo Jack
  • Optical Drive: DVD+/-RW Burner
  • Color: Black with Mist Blue Mesh
  • Includes: Wired USB Keyboard & USB Mouse, Power Cable
  • Warranty: 2-Year Warranty
